I'm trying to download file with konqueror (and kget). File with the same name is already exists (file was changed, and I want to redownload it).

So konqueror tells me that there is a file with same name and it suggests me to rename new file. But I want to overwrite old file.

There is no overwrite button. There is button, which generates new name, button which renames, and cancel.

It's KDE 4.3.2. How can I overwrite file?! It's really strange that there is no such simple button!

Well it seems that button disappears, when kget integration is enabled
